EMDR, Expressive Arts, and Dissociative Presentations
Facilitators: Marshall Lyles, LMFT-S, LPC-S, RPT-S, EMDRIA Approved Consultant
Date: December 11-12, 2026 (9a - 4:45pm CST for both days)
CEs: 12 EMDRIA CEs (EC Program Approval Number: #18012-33)
Description: Art-based creations and poetic practices have been healing agents across cultures and for generations. Both art and poetry offer space within a therapeutic context where time can momentarily pause as different inner voices receive the attention they need to feel empowered, even dissociatively-held parts of self. In this workshop, participants will enhance their work as clinicians by hearing about how the expressive arts can be embraced by EMDR clinicians in addressing trauma-related dissociative presentations.
Objectives:
Identify the basic tenets of EMDR and how they can be applied to expressive arts processes
Describe EMDR treatment planning for complex trauma needs
Discuss dissociation from a nervous system point-of-view
Describe attachment theory’s impact on treating dissociation with EMDR
Identify 3 healing outcomes of EMDR-informed expressive therapy with those impacted by a range of dissociative presentations
Apply attachment-aware expressive tools to EMDR resourcing for those with complex trauma related dissociation
Apply attachment-aware expressive tools to EMDR reprocessing for those with complex trauma related dissociation
Discuss client behaviors in expressive art EMDR sessions that can reveal pockets of emerging dissociation
